The King and Queen of Hearts in Court, 1889. Lewis Carrolls (1832-1898) Alice in Wonderland as illustrated by John Tenniel (1820-1914). From Alices Adventures in Wonderland by Lewis Carroll. [Macmillan & Co. New York, 1889]

This print, titled "The King and Queen of Hearts in Court, 1889" takes us on a whimsical journey into the enchanting world of Lewis Carroll's Alice in Wonderland. Illustrated by the talented John Tenniel, this image captures a pivotal moment within the story. In this Victorian-era courtroom scene, we find ourselves amidst an extraordinary trial. The regal King and Queen of Hearts preside over the proceedings with their characteristic eccentricity. Surrounded by an array of peculiar characters including a mischievous White Rabbit and a colorful parrot perched upon its stand, the atmosphere is filled with anticipation. Tenniel's intricate engraving skillfully brings to life Carroll's imaginative narrative. Every detail is meticulously crafted - from the elaborate costumes worn by each character to their expressive facial expressions that hint at both humor and tension.
